Set up your Frequently Bought Together Offer

Set up your Frequently Bought Together Offer

What is Frequently Bought Together and Its Benefits?


Frequently Bought Together (FBT) is a bundle widget that displays a curated group of related products directly on your Product Page, as a set customers can add to cart in a single click.


Instead of making shoppers hunt for accessories or complementary items, FBT brings everything to one place. It shows the main product alongside handpicked add-ons, letting customers complete their purchase instantly.



Example: An office furniture store sets up FBT for their Work Chair. When customers land on that page, they also see a Lumbar Cushion, Floor Mat, and Monitor Stand, all pre-selected and ready to bundle. One click adds everything to the cart.


FBT drives real business results across three key areas:


  • Higher Average Order Value

  • Smoother Shopping Journey

  • Better Product Discovery

  • Flexible Merchant Control


Step by Step To Set Up Frequently Bought Together

Step 1: Getting Started


1.1. Open the App


Go to G: Volume Discounts in your Shopify admin and navigate to the Offers tab on the left side Create Offer



1.2. Create a New Offer


Click Bundle & SaveFrequently Bought Together → Pick between Stack (vertical list) or Carousel layout. Both have the same configuration options and can be changed later.



Step 2: Configure your Frequently Bought Together offer


On this page, there are four tabs where you can configure each criteria of your offer.


Tab 1: General

Configure the basics of your offer: who sees it, where, and when.

1.1. Name: An internal label for your offer in your Shopify Admin (not shown to customers).
1.2. Priority: Higher number = shown first when multiple offers apply. 
  • 0 = the lowest priority
  • 1 = the highest priority
  • 2 = the second highest priority
  • 3 = the third highest priority
  • And more.
1.3. Status: Set to Active to make it live immediately or Draft to save for later.
1.4. Apply to Products: Choose All Products, a Specific Product, or a Custom Segment.
  1. All Product: Select this to apply the offer for all products on your storefront.
  2. Specific product: Search for products to be applied with this offer by typing in the search bar or click the Browse button.
  1. Custom Segment: Control which segments can receive the offer. There are 4 rules of custom segments and you can add up to 4 rules for a single FBT offer.

Product by tags
Select products based on specific tags (e.g. “sales”, “new”, “pro”)
Type a tag in the ‘Enter tag product’ bar. To add more tags, simply click the + button and type in more. 

Logical conditions (dropdown):
  1. Include all: Only apply for products that have all the entered tags.
  2. Include any: Apply for all products that have at least 1 among the entered tags. 
  3. Exclude all: Apply all except for products that have all the entered tags.
  4. Exclude any: Apply all except for products that have at least 1 among the entered tags. 

Edit Quantity Discount & Volume Discount

Products type
Filter the products according to the product type (custom product categories e.g. Color lines, Sleeves color, etc.)

Logical conditions (dropdown):
  1. Is: Apply for products that meet the entered type.
  2. Is not: Apply for products that are not in the entered type.

Edit Quantity Discount & Volume Discount

Products by vendors

Products by collection
Target products that belong to specific collections. 
Search for collections to be applied with the offer by clicking the Browse button.
Products by collection

1.5. Customer Criteria: Show the offer to All Customers or a specific Custom Segment.
1.5.1. All customers: Select this for the offer to be available for all customers.
1.5.2. Custom segment

Login status
Apply the offer based on the login status of customers. Choose between Logged in or Logged out.

Customer tags (Only for Logged in users)
Filter customers using custom tags (e.g., "VIP", "wholesale")
Logical conditions (dropdown):
  1. Include all: Only apply for customers that have all the entered tags.
  2. Include any: Apply for all customers that have at least 1 among the entered tags. 
  3. Exclude all: Apply all except for customers that have all the entered tags.
  4. Exclude any: Apply all except for customers that have at least 1 among the entered tags. 

Edit Quantity Discount & Volume Discount

Country
Filter customers based on their country of residence.
Search for countries and tick on what countries you want to apply this offer to.

Edit Quantity Discount & Volume Discount

Total amount spent (Only Logged in users)
Target customers who have spent a certain total amount
Set the minimum and maximum spending limit of the customers for the offer.

Amount spent (Only Logged in users)

Number of orders (Only Logged in users)
Target customers based on how many orders they’ve placed
Set the minimum and maximum number of orders completed limit of the customers for the offer.

Orders completed (Only Logged in users)

Customer type (Only Logged in users)
Choose which customer types this offer applies to:
  1. B2B Customers: Customers who belong to the store’s B2B catalog.
  2. Retail Customers: Regular retail customers.
  3. Both: Applies to both B2B and Retail customers.


Tab 2: Discount Tiers

This is where you define what appears inside the FBT widget: the text, the products, and any discounts.
2.1. Text
Customize the copy your shoppers see in the FBT widget:
  • Title:  e.g. "Frequently Bought Together"
  • Subtitle:  e.g. "Don't miss out on these complements to complete your set!"
  • Action Button: e.g. "Bundle & Save"
  • Total Text: Label for the bundle price summary, e.g. "BUNDLE SAVINGS:"

This is how the text is shown, you can view it in the Preview section on the right side.
2.2. Offer Products
Add the products you want to recommend. There is no limit on how many products you can add per offer.
For each product slot, choose how it's sourced using Product Suggest:
  1. Shopify AI Recommendation: Uses Shopify's built-in recommendation algorithm to auto-select a relevant product.
  2. Specific Product: Manually browse and pin one exact product from your store catalog
  3. Product from Same Collection: Pulls a product from the same collection as the viewed item. Choose between Random Product (a random item from the collection) or Best Selling Product (the top-selling item in that collection).
  4. Product from Specific Collection: Pulls a product from any collection you choose. Choose between Random Product (a random item from the collection) or Best Selling Product (the top-selling item in that collection).

Select by Default: When enabled, that product is pre-checked in the widget so customers see it already included in their bundle. You can enable this for unlimited products.

2.3. Apply Discount
Toggle on to offer a discount across all products in the bundle (including the main product and the add-ons) . Two discount types are available:
  • Percentage Discount: e.g. 10% off every item in the bundle.
  • Fixed Discount: e.g. a fixed amount per item like $10, $20, etc.
2.4. Add Free Gifts (Coming soon): Will allow you to add a free gift when customers purchase all products in the bundle.

Tab 3: Design

Control how the FBT widget looks on your storefront so it feels native to your brand.

*Use the live Preview panel on the right to see changes in real time as you adjust design settings.


3.1. Layout: Toggle between Stack (vertical list) or Carousel (horizontal scroll). Both support the same configuration.
3.2. Widget Layout: Adjust product padding, spacing, horizontal/vertical padding, product width, and widget spacing.

3.3. Widget Background: Set a background color for the entire FBT widget.
3.4. Product Background: Customize individual product card backgrounds and appearance.
3.5. Widget/Product/Form Colors: Customize colors of each component.
3.6. Typography: Where to typography of widget title & subtitle, product title & subtitle, total text, product compare price, action button, and total price.

Tab 4: Advanced
Additional control options, consistent with other offer types in the app:


  • Schedule Offer: Set a start and end date/time to run the FBT offer during specific periods.
    • Run campaign continuously: The campaign will start immediately and run until you deactivate it.
    • Run campaign on schedule: The campaign will run on a specific schedule you define.
    • Tick Set end date to schedule the end time of the offer

  • Translation: Translate widget text into multiple languages for international storefronts.

Step 3:  Save & Publish Your Offer


Once all four tabs are configured, click Save changes. You'll see a warning banner, this is expected.




Info
Important: Add the FBT Block to Your Theme
The FBT widget will not appear on your storefront until the FBT Block is added to your product page theme. Here's how:

  • Click "Active Widget" in the warning banner at the top of the Offers page, click the Active Widget button.

  • Auto-redirected to Theme Editor: The app will open Shopify's Theme Editor and automatically insert the FBT Block into your Default Product Page template.

  • Save in Theme Editor: Click Save in the Theme Editor. Your FBT widget is now live on your storefront.


Start implementing your Frequently Bought Together offer today and see your AOV roars. If you meet any issue, feel free to reach out us at: support@tapita.io

    • Related Articles

    • Set up your Quantity Breaks Discount Offer

      Boost sales for a single product, average order value (AOV), or clear excess inventory with ‘Quantity Breaks’ Offer in G: Volume Discounts & Upsell. Paired with 5+ interactive templates, they are designed to help Shopify merchants drive larger ...
    • Set up your Quantity Discount and Volume Discount Offers

      Boost sales for a single product or any products, boosting average order value (AOV), or clear excess inventory with ‘Quantity Discount’ Offer and ‘Volume Discount’ Offer in G: Volume Discounts & Upsell. They are designed to help Shopify merchants ...
    • Getting Started to G: Volume Discounts & Upsell

      Introduction Struggle to boost your Shopify store’s average order value (AOV) or clear out excess inventory? Do your customers often abandon carts with only one or two items? G: Volume Discounts & Upsell is here to solve these worries. This ...
    • Adding the Embedded Countdown Timer to your Discount Widget

      A countdown timer displayed directly in the discount widget creates a sense of urgency for customers, encouraging them to complete their purchase sooner. It also helps clear excess inventory quickly and boosts average order value—customers rush to ...
    • Table Layout Discount Widget in Quantity Discount and Volume Discount

      The Table layout displays your discount tiers in a clear, structured table format. It provides the same functionality as the Stack layout while offering additional customization options in the Offer blocks and Design tabs, making complex tiered ...